The TPS70245PWPG4 is a dual-output LDO regulator providing fixed 1.2 V at 0.5 A and 3.3 V at 0.25 A outputs, with a 3.641 V to 6 V input range, low 170 mV dropout voltage, and a 20-pin HTSSOP package with exposed pad.

What are the key features of TPS70245PWPG4?

  • Dual fixed LDO outputs: 1.2 V at 500 mA and 3.3 V at 250 mA
  • Low dropout voltage: typically 170 mV, maximum 275 mV
  • Wide input voltage range: 3.641 V to 6 V (absolute max 7 V)
  • Excellent line regulation: max 0.0039% for tight output accuracy
  • 20-pin HTSSOP package with exposed thermal pad for heat dissipation
  • JESD-609 e4 (Pb-free) and RoHS-compliant for green designs

What is TPS70245PWPG4 used for?

The TPS70245PWPG4 is ideal for powering dual-rail digital subsystems such as FPGA core and I/O voltage supplies, DSP processors, and mixed-signal boards that require both 1.2 V and 3.3 V simultaneously from a single 5 V or 3.6 V+ input. It is also used in portable industrial instruments and communication modules where low-noise LDO regulation from a compact package reduces BOM complexity.

Frequently Asked Questions

What output voltages and current ratings does TPS70245PWPG4 deliver simultaneously?

TPS70245PWPG4 provides two simultaneous fixed outputs: 1.2 V at up to 500 mA and 3.3 V at up to 250 mA, making it a compact dual-rail solution for mixed-voltage boards that need both a low-core logic supply and a standard I/O voltage from one regulator.

How low is the dropout voltage of TPS70245PWPG4 and what minimum input voltage is required?

The TPS70245PWPG4 has a typical dropout voltage of 170 mV with a maximum of 275 mV; the specified minimum input voltage is 3.641 V, so a 3.8 V to 6 V input comfortably covers both outputs with sufficient headroom across temperature and load conditions.

In what design scenarios does TPS70245PWPG4 reduce BOM count compared to using two separate LDO ICs?

Any design needing both 1.2 V core and 3.3 V I/O rails — such as FPGAs, ARM microcontrollers, or Ethernet PHYs — benefits from TPS70245PWPG4's dual output in a single 20-pin HTSSOP footprint, cutting PCB area, component count, and procurement complexity versus two discrete LDOs.

Does the exposed thermal pad on the HTSSOP package help manage power dissipation in high-current scenarios?

Yes, the 20-pin HTSSOP exposed pad (EP) on TPS70245PWPG4 allows direct solder attachment to a PCB copper pour, significantly reducing junction-to-board thermal resistance and enabling the device to sustain its full 500 mA output without overheating at elevated ambient temperatures up to 85°C.
